bǎo treasure Traditional

Depicts an assortment of valuable things, including jade () and shells (), being stored safely under a roof (). The component represents the sound.

Components

Iconic component
mián roof
𤣩
𤣩 Iconic component
jade

𤣩 is a component form of .

Sound component
fǒu pottery
Iconic component
bèi sea shell

In ancient China shells were used as currency.
